Harris Teeter Opens at Hope Valley Commons

Harris Teeter opened yesterday as the anchor of the new shopping center at the corner of Highway 54 and Hope Valley Rd. (Highway 751), Hope Valley Commons, in the rapidly growing Southwest part of Durham.
The store is similar to the one on Martin Luther King Parkway, but newer and bigger than the one near the corner of 54 and Fayetteville.

Some features of note:

  • olive bar
  • salad bar
  • large prepared foods / deli area
  • order ahead and pickup groceries at scheduled time
  • open 24 hours
  • pharmacy
  • Harry the Dragon ride for little ones*
  • parking reserved for customers with children, beside a covered tent for buggies (like the Chapel Hill North Harris Teeter)
  • rocket-themed buggies for kids
  • Starbucks (looks like Durham increased the number of Starbucks while other towns were losing locations)
  • large floral selection

As others have noted, the parking lot seems smallish, and I learned not to park in the main row coming off the entrance because of the number of incoming cars. We will probably continue to shop at the MLK location, but this Harris Teeter has a large market in the neighborhoods south of us.

The dragon ride is 50 cents and the song has changed. I miss the “Go Harry! Go Harry! Go Harris Teeter Dragon!” but it’s good to see he’s back in service.
